Binyamina’s Baby: Binyamina ‘B’ 2008
Posted on November 27, 2008
Baby Binyamina is the first release of the 2008 vintage from Binyamina Winery. A light and fruity wine, it was released one minute after midnight on November 20. Like Beaujolais wine, the Binyamina B underwent carbonic maceration. This means that this young wine is meant for immediate drinking and not long-term storage.
Unlike Beaujolais wine, the Binyamina B is made of one-hundred percent Carignan grapes and has twelve percent alcohol content. This grape originates in Spain and has a rich purple color. The grapes were hand harvested from old vines. It’s just one of many enjoyable and unique Israeli wines, available only in Israel.
